 | | Haemodracon-species belong to a group of oldworld-geckos formerly known as Phyllodactylus. |
 | | The other ones are called: Goggia (SouthAfrica) Haemodracon (Sokotra-Island) Euleptes (Mediterranean) Dixonius (SE-Asia) Cryptactites (S-Africa) Afrogecko (S-Africa) You can read about this in Aaron M.Bauer, FDavid A. Good & William R.Branch:The TAxonomy of southern african leaf-toed geckos with a review of old world Phyllodactylus and the description of five new genera. |
